Beadboard Painting in Wilmington, NC
Beadboard painting services involve the application of fresh paint or stain to beadboard paneling, a decorative wood or MDF material often used in interior walls, wainscoting, or ceiling accents. This service is suitable for a variety of projects, including updating the look of living rooms, kitchens, bathrooms, or entryways, as well as restoring or enhancing existing beadboard surfaces. Homeowners typically seek this service to refresh outdated finishes, change color schemes, or improve the overall appearance of their interior spaces with a smooth, even finish that highlights the beadboard’s detailed profile.
Before requesting beadboard painting, property owners usually want to understand the condition of the existing surface, including any necessary prep work such as cleaning, sanding, or repairing damaged areas. It’s also helpful to consider the type of paint or stain best suited for the material and location, especially in areas prone to moisture or humidity. Clear communication about color choices, finishes, and desired aesthetics can ensure the final result aligns with the homeowner’s vision.

Beadboard Painting Questions
What is beadboard painting? Beadboard painting involves applying a fresh coat of paint to beadboard paneling to enhance its appearance and protect the surface.
Which areas are suitable for beadboard painting? Beadboard painting is commonly used in kitchens, bathrooms, and wainscoting to add a decorative touch and improve durability.
How should beadboard be prepared before painting? The surface should be cleaned thoroughly, sanded lightly, and any imperfections should be repaired for a smooth finish.
What are common finishes for beadboard painting? Matte, satin, and semi-gloss are popular choices that provide different levels of sheen and durability.
